I came here with a couple of friends for High Tea to celebrate their birthdays. While the food was very nice and the service staff very pleasant, the experience felt a little off - there were construction works going on outside, so there was plastic sheeting everywhere. More importantly, though, the Grand Millennium is both nowhere near the central, happening part of Auckland CBD and therefore feels a little "dead". We saw a few guests here and there, but the place felt weirdly empty. The kicker, though, is that the promotional photos and the description - hell, even the name "Aviary" makes it seem you're going somewhere upstairs, with a view. Nope - this is literally in the hotel foyer, and isn't remotely removed from people coming and going; staff and guest alike.
The food was very pleasant! A couple of really tasty, interesting nibbles such as the paté and the savoury cake-like thing served at the beginning. The brown sugar cream served with the scones was something we considered holding the staff hostage for in demand of the recipe. It's a shame that so many items on the menu had alcohol - one of my guests and I don't drink, and even if the volume was low, the taste prevailed.
The staff member who served us was absolutely lovely and had a good sense of humour. Somehow, it seemed like he was actually not meant to be a direct customer service person; he gave off an air of being a manager or above, so it felt a little odd...but overall, he was lovely.
